Abstract

The utility model discloses an automatic charging device for an AGV (automatic guided vehicle), which comprises a charging station and a charging module, wherein the charging module is arranged on the AGV and is in butt joint with the charging station; the charging station comprises a charging seat; the charging module comprises a charging plug and a locking device; the charging plug is aligned with the charging seat through the alignment device; the locking device is used for locking the aligned charging plug and the aligned socket together. According to the utility model, the charging station is arranged, the charging module is arranged on the AGV trolley, and the charging module is aligned with the socket of the charging station through the alignment device, so that when the AGV trolley is out of power, automatic charging can be realized, a specially-assigned person is not required to take care of the AGV trolley, the manpower is saved, and the degree of automation is higher.

Description

Automatic charging device of AGV dolly
Technical Field
The utility model relates to an AGV trolley charging technology, in particular to an AGV trolley automatic charging device.
Background
With the continuous progress of computer technology and artificial intelligence technology, automated work systems similar to AGVs have begun to slowly move into people's lives. The automatic working system is greatly popular because the user is liberated from tedious, time-consuming and labor-consuming manual operation without being invested in energy management after being set once.
Generally, industrial AGVs use high quality on-board rechargeable batteries to power themselves, and due to the limited capacity of the on-board power supply, the AGVs are limited in their operating time, typically only for a few hours, and once the power is exhausted, manual intervention must be used to recharge the transport. When the AGV is insufficient in power, a prompt signal is sent, the electric connection between the transport vehicle and the charger is manually completed by an operator, then the charging is implemented, and the AGV is also manually separated from the charging connection circuit after the charging is completed. Although the charging mode is safe, reliable, simple and feasible, the charging mode needs a specially-assigned person to take care of, manpower is wasted, and automation and intellectualization of the AGV are incomplete.
SUMMERY OF THE UTILITY MODEL
The utility model aims to provide an automatic charging device for an AGV, aiming at the problems that in the prior art, a special person needs to take care of the AGV during charging and manpower is wasted.
The technical scheme for realizing the purpose of the utility model is as follows: an automatic charging device for an AGV comprises a charging station and a charging module, wherein the charging module is arranged on the AGV and is in butt joint with the charging station; the charging station comprises a charging seat; the charging module comprises a charging plug and a locking device; the charging plug is aligned with the charging seat through the alignment device; the locking device is used for locking the aligned charging plug and the aligned socket together.
The charging station further comprises a charging box; the charging seat is arranged on the charging box in a telescopic manner through the guide rod.
The charging module further comprises a mounting plate; the mounting plate is connected to the AGV trolley in a sliding manner through a sliding rail; the charging plug is fixed on the mounting plate.
The alignment device comprises a positioning plate, a positioning strip and a connecting rod; the positioning plates are symmetrically arranged on two sides of the charging plug and fixedly connected with the mounting plate; the positioning strips are symmetrically arranged on two sides of the charging seat and are in sliding connection with the charging box; the connecting rods are symmetrically arranged on two sides of the charging seat; one ends of the two connecting rods are hinged to the charging seat, the other ends of the two connecting rods are hinged to the two positioning strips respectively, and a reset piece is connected between each positioning strip and the middle of the charging box.
The locking device comprises a locking plate; the locking plate is connected above the charging plug in a vertically sliding manner through a sliding rod; two locking hooks for hooking the charging seat are symmetrically arranged on the locking plate; and the locking plate is provided with a driving mechanism for driving the locking plate to lift.
The driving mechanism comprises a driving motor; and a screw rod in threaded connection with the charging plug is fixed on an output shaft of the driving motor.
A first contact sensor is arranged on the contact surface of the charging plug and the charging seat; an MCU is arranged in the charging plug; and the first contact sensor and the driving motor are electrically connected with the MCU.
Two second contact sensors are arranged on the upper portion and the lower portion of the side wall of the charging plug; metal contact pieces moving up and down along with the locking plate are arranged on the locking plate corresponding to the two second contact sensors; and the second contact sensor is electrically connected with the MCU uniformly arranged on the metal contact piece.
The piece that resets is the extension spring.
By adopting the technical scheme, the utility model has the following beneficial effects: (1) according to the utility model, the charging station is arranged, the charging module is arranged on the AGV trolley, and the charging module is aligned with the socket of the charging station through the alignment device, so that when the AGV trolley is out of power, automatic charging can be realized, a specially-assigned person is not required to take care of the AGV trolley, the manpower is saved, and the degree of automation is higher.
(2) The charging station is provided with the charging box, and the charging seat is telescopically arranged on the charging box through the guide rod so as to ensure that the charging seat is well butted with the charging plug.
(3) The charging module further comprises a mounting plate, the mounting plate is connected to the AGV through a sliding rail in a sliding mode, and the charging plug is fixed to the mounting plate. So that when the charging plug is in butt joint with the charging seat, the charging plug can move, and the charging plug is further ensured to be in accurate butt joint with the charging seat.
(4) The positioning plates and the positioning strips are arranged, when the AGV trolley needs to be charged, the AGV trolley moves towards the charging seat, the positioning strips move towards two sides and are in contact with the two positioning plates, and when the positioning strips move to the limit positions, the positioning strips are just inserted into the charging seat, so that smooth charging is ensured.
(5) The utility model is provided with the locking device, which can effectively prevent the charging plug from being separated from the charging seat, thereby not only ensuring the charging stability, but also preventing the charging plug from generating electric arc with the charging seat and ensuring the charging safety.
(6) The locking device provided by the utility model adopts the driving motor to drive the locking plate to lift, so that the locking hook can hook the charging seat, and the locking device is simple in structure and high in locking stability.
(7) The utility model is provided with the first contact sensor, when the charging seat is contacted with the charging plug, the MCU can automatically control the driving motor to work and lock, and the degree of automation is higher.
(8) The utility model is provided with the second contact sensor, can limit the movement stroke of the locking plate, informs the driving motor of the movement state of the locking plate, and further improves the automation degree.
(9) According to the automatic positioning device, the reset piece is arranged, when the AGV trolley is moved away after charging is completed, the positioning strip is reset under the action of the reset piece, so that alignment is performed when charging is performed next time, manual reset is not needed, and the charging automation degree is further improved.

Detailed Description
(example 1)
Referring to fig. 1 to 3, an automatic charging device for an AGV according to this embodiment includes a charging station 1 and a charging module 2 disposed on the AGV and in butt joint with the charging station 1; the charging station 1 comprises a charging seat 1-1; the charging module 2 comprises a charging plug 2-1 and a locking device 2-2; the charging plug 2-1 is aligned with the charging seat 1-1 through the alignment device 3; the locking device 2-2 is used for locking the aligned charging plug 2-1 and the aligned socket together.
Further, the charging station 1 further comprises a charging box 1-2; the charging seat 1-1 is telescopically arranged on the charging box 1-2 through a guide rod 1-3 so as to ensure that the charging seat 1-1 is well butted with the charging plug 2-1.
Further, the charging module 2 further comprises a mounting plate 2-3; the mounting plate 2-3 is connected to the AGV trolley in a sliding mode through a sliding rail 2-4; the charging plug 2-1 is fixed on the mounting plate 2-3, so that when the charging seat 1-1 is in butt joint with the charging plug 2-1, the movement of the charging plug 2-1 is ensured, and the accuracy of alignment is ensured.
Further, the aligning device 3 comprises a positioning plate 3-1, a positioning strip 3-2 and a connecting rod 3-3; the positioning plates 3-1 are symmetrically arranged on two sides of the charging plug 2-1 and fixedly connected with the mounting plates 2-3; the positioning strips 3-2 are symmetrically arranged on two sides of the charging seat 1-1 and are connected with the charging box 1-2 in a sliding manner; the connecting rods 3-3 are symmetrically arranged at two sides of the charging seat 1-1; one end of each connecting rod 3-3 is hinged with the charging seat 1-1, the other end of each connecting rod is hinged with the corresponding positioning strip 3-2, a reset piece 3-4 is connected between each positioning strip 3-2 and the middle part of the corresponding charging box 1-2, and preferably, the reset pieces 3-4 are tension springs. When the AGV trolley needs to be charged, the AGV trolley moves towards the charging seat 1-1, the positioning strips 3-2 move towards two sides and are in contact with the two positioning plates 3-1, when the positioning strips 3-2 move to the limit positions, the positioning strips are just inserted into the charging seat 1-1 to ensure smooth charging, and the accurate positioning of the charging plug 2-1 and the charging seat 1-1 is ensured through the contact of the positioning strips 3-2 and the limiting plates, so that the structure is simple, and the use cost is low. The reset piece 3-4 is arranged, when the AGV trolley is moved away after charging is completed, the positioning strip 3-2 is reset under the action of the reset piece 3-4, so that alignment is carried out when charging is carried out next time, manual reset is not needed, and the charging automation degree is further improved.
Further, the locking device 2-2 comprises a locking plate 2-2-1; the locking plate 2-2-1 is connected above the charging plug 2-1 in a vertically sliding manner through a sliding rod 2-2-2; two locking hooks 2-2-3 for hooking the charging seat 1-1 are symmetrically arranged on the locking plate 2-2-1; the locking plate 2-2-1 is provided with a driving mechanism 4 for driving the locking plate 2-2-1 to lift, and the charging seat 1-1 and the charging plug 2-1 are locked by the locking hook 2-2-3, so that the charging stability can be ensured, the phenomenon that electric arcs are generated due to the separation of the charging seat 1-1 and the charging plug 2-1 during charging is avoided, and the charging safety is ensured.
Further, the driving mechanism 4 comprises a driving motor 4-1; the screw rod 4-2 in threaded connection with the charging plug 2-1 is fixed on the output shaft of the driving motor 4-1, so that the structure is simple, and the driving effect is good.
Further, a first contact sensor 4-3 is arranged on a contact surface of the charging plug 2-1 and the charging seat 1-1; an MCU is arranged in the charging plug 2-1; the first contact sensor 4-3 and the driving motor 4-1 are electrically connected with the MCU, so that the automatic operation of the driving motor 4-1 is ensured, and the automatic degree of locking is improved.
Furthermore, two second contact sensors 4-4 are arranged on the upper portion and the lower portion of the side wall of the charging plug 2-1; a metal contact piece moving up and down along with the locking plate 2-2-1 is arranged on the locking plate 2-2-1 corresponding to the two second contact sensors 4-4; the second contact sensor 4-4 is electrically connected with the metal contact piece uniform MCU, the movement stroke of the driving motor 4-1 is controlled through the two second contact sensors 4-4, when charging is completed, the driving motor 4-1 can be informed that the locking plate 2-2-1 moves to the second contact sensor 4-4 above, and the automation degree is further improved.
The automatic charging device of AGV dolly of this embodiment has set up charging station 1 and has set up the module of charging 2 on the AGV dolly, and the module of charging 2 is counterpointed through aligning device 3 and charging station 1's socket, when the AGV dolly does not have the electricity, can realize automatic charging, need not the special messenger and guard, has practiced thrift the manpower, and degree of automation is higher moreover.
